Live casino settings: blending real-time communication with virtual structures

Live dealer games transmit video broadcasts from actual studios where trained dealers operate tables furnished with optical character identification technology. Multiple camera views record card reveals and wheel rotations while software layers present betting interfaces. Chat functions enable communication between participants and dealers through moderated text channels. Flexible bitrate transmission alters video resolution based on connection speed to sustain continuous gameplay.

The criticality of velocity: rendering time, reactivity, and preservation

Page load rates directly relate with participant preservation percentages, as delays beyond three seconds elevate abandonment likelihood. Material distribution networks allocate fixed assets across global server positions to decrease lag. Caching approaches retain frequently retrieved data locally to minimize server queries and speed up page loads. Code enhancement removes excessive scripts and compresses files to enhance display performance across devices.

Frequent technological problems and how platforms seek to prevent them

Server congestion during highest traffic times causes slowdowns that casino platforms reduce through auto-scaling framework that adds processing assets automatically. Game freezes result from memory losses or incompatible giocagile browser versions, prompting programmers to implement error recording structures for troubleshooting. Payment execution failures happen when gateway connections timeout, prompting platforms to incorporate secondary processors that engage during operation outages. Session interruptions during live dealer games activate reconnection procedures that recover player positions. Scheduled maintenance intervals enable groups to deploy updates and optimize database performance.
